What You Will Do:

  • Develop and enhance SailPoint IdentityIQ solutions, including provisioning, de-provisioning, and access governance.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ams such as DevOps, Business Systems Analysts, and security stakeholders to drive IAM initiatives.
  • Conduct root cause analysis, troubleshoot issues, and optimize SailPoint implementations.
  • Design and document solutions, ensuring seamless integrations with existing business applications.
  • Engage in ongoing system enhancements, automation, and process improvements.
  • Participate in SDLC implementation cycles, ensuring security best practices and compliance.
  • Actively contribute ideas, ask questions, and collaborate to improve identity management strategies.

What Gets You The Job: 

  • 5+ years of SailPoint development experience, ideally transitioning from a broader software development background.
  • Proficiency in Java or a major scripting language, with the ability to read and analyze code.
  • Experience with IdentityIQ modules such as Lifecycle Management (LCM), Provisioning, and Access Reviews.
  • Strong understanding of IAM principles, security frameworks, and SDLC processes.
  • Ability to interact with multiple teams, drive technical conversations, and document design decisions.
  • Experience integrating SailPoint with on-prem and cloud-based applications.
  • Familiarity with DevOps tools and C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, Bitbucket, etc.) is a plus.
